This course is to explain and outline the general requirements of the new federal law known as H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act-1996), which focuses on safeguarding the privacy and confidentiality of personal health information of patients.
The course will provide specific details of the HIPAA Privacy Rule (45 CFR Parts 160, 162 and 164) Standards and their applications to all health care providers, health plans, clearinghouses and their business associates.
After a successful completion of this course, the health care providers and their staff members will be able to understand the requirements for HIPAA compliance and sanctions for non-compliance.
